When customers report totals that are off by a cent or two, it is almost always a rounding artifact in Coinlane's currency conversion, not a charging error. We convert at mid-market rates, round half-up to the smallest unit, and reconcile differences internally, so customers are never undercredited overall. Do not offer manual adjustments for sub-cent discrepancies. The worked examples and approved reply templates are on the internal page.

operations page: https://jenkins.zemvarcloud.local/job/merge_requests/repo/build/73930b4b30f0a8ed

## Step 4 — Deploy spoolerd

Build the printer-spooler image from the `release` branch. Tag it with the sprint number, not the commit hash — the Quillfax fleet controller rejects untagged images. Push to the internal registry, then run `spoolctl rollout --canary 2` and watch queue depth on the Harkwell dashboard for five minutes. If depth stays under 200 jobs, promote to the full fleet. Rollback is `spoolctl rollout --abort`. All images must be signed before the registry accepts them; use the deploy key that follows.

rollout seal: bky4_x7Gc

Subject: Handover — Pixelcrumb Resizer Releases

Hi Torv,

Taking over from me on the Pixelcrumb batch-resizing CLI: releases go out every second Thursday. Build from the release branch only, run the full fixture suite (watch the WebP edge cases — they've bitten us twice), then tag and sign. The macOS notarization step must finish before the checksum file is generated, or downstream mirrors reject the bundle. Signing for the distribution channel is done with the key below.

release key, yagap-kagag: bky6_1ks93y